CVE-2023-23800
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edServer-Side Request Forgery (SSRF) vulnerability in Vova Anokhin WP Shortcodes Plugin — Shortcodes Ultimate.This issue affects WP Shortcodes Plugin — Shortcodes Ultimate: from n/a through 5.12.6.

dbcve analysis · moderate confidenceServer-Side Request Forgery (SSRF) vulnerability in the Shortcodes Ultimate WordPress plugin allows attackers to make the vulnerable server perform arbitrary HTTP requests to internal or external resources. The vulnerability exists in versions up to 5.12.6 due to insufficient validation of user-supplied URLs in the plugin's shortcode functionality.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Verify Shortcodes Ultimate plugin is installedLog into WordPress admin, navigate to Plugins > Installed Plugins, and look for 'Shortcodes Ultimate' or 'Getshortcodes' in the list. Check if it shows as 'Active'.Affected if Plugin is installed and active with version 5.12.6 or lower
-
Check installed plugin versionIn WordPress admin, go to Plugins > Installed Plugins. Click on 'Shortcodes Ultimate' to view the plugin details, or check the plugin file /wp-content/plugins/shortcodes-ultimate/shortcodes-ultimate.php for the 'Version' header comment.Affected if Version displayed is 5.12.6 or any lower version number
-
Identify vulnerable shortcode usageSearch WordPress posts, pages, and widget content for shortcodes that accept URL parameters, such as [su_animate], [su_button], or any shortcode that might accept a 'url' or 'link' attribute that could be controlled by user input.Affected if Any content uses shortcodes from this plugin with URL-related attributes
-
Review server access logs for suspicious requestsExamine web server access logs (Apache, Nginx) for the site for unusual outbound requests originating from the server, especially to internal resources (127.0.0.1, 192.168.x.x, 10.x.x.x) or unexpected external domains that coincide with the time frame the plugin was active.Affected if Logs show the server making outbound HTTP requests that were not initiated by legitimate administrator actions
-
Check for unexpected scheduled tasks or cron jobsIn WordPress admin, go to Tools > Scheduled Events or review wp_options table for cron entries that may indicate the vulnerability was exploited to create persistent scheduled tasks.Affected if New or unfamiliar scheduled tasks appear that were not created by the administrator
A user is affected if the Shortcodes Ultimate plugin is installed and active with version 5.12.6 or lower, particularly if the vulnerable shortcode functionality is accessible to untrusted users.
